- The distance between Syktyvkar, Russia and Waterloo Wellington, On, Canada is approximately 7,532 km or 4,681 mi.
- To reach Syktyvkar in this distance one would set out from Waterloo Wellington, On bearing 22.7°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Syktyvkar bearing 143.8° or SE .
- Syktyvkar has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Waterloo Wellington, On has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Syktyvkar is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Waterloo Wellington, On is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 6 °C (10.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.7 °C (12.1°F) more in Syktyvkar.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 362.4 mm (14.3 in) less which is equivalent to 362.4 l/m² (8.89 US gal/ft²) or 3,624,000 l/ha (387,430 US gal/ac) less. About 3/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.1° lower in Syktyvkar than in Waterloo Wellington, On.
